Brazil to remain key

Demand for ethanol, which competes with sugar for cane in countries such as Brazil, is seen increasing, as the share of cane going to make the biofuel rises from around 20% average over 2012-14 to 26% in 2024.

Brazil is seen as keeping its dominant position as a sugar exporter, at around 40% of global exports, while Thailand boosts its market share.
